Lens Test!!! Found an old 2x Nikon Teleextender, so we put it on a normal camera at a manual setting. We had EI 800 Fuji film in the camera, so thats what we used. The sun was pretty bright this day. The lens was a Nikkor 100 to 300 zoom set at 300mm or, 600mm as it turns out. The lens was stopped down to f/8 which turns out to be around f/16 (probably more like T/22). Theres a polarizer over the end of the lens which made focusing a guess, we guessed infinity in this case. There was a sun shade. It was on a monopod. The shutter speed was around 1/250, and I tried to not be shaking when I took it. I'll be damned if it didn't work.
